- 7Why does my car drive sideways down the road?Vehicles track at an angle because the frame is no longer square, often as a result of a previous severe collision. This structural misalignment prevents the front and rear wheels from tracking in the same path, creating the visual effect of driving sideways.
- 2Why does my steering wheel pull or turn by itself?Power steering malfunctions can cause the steering wheel to automatically jerk or pull hard in one direction while the engine is running, making it nearly impossible to steer the other way. This sudden loss of control prevents safe driving and can also cause the steering wheel to shake visibly when let go before pulling to the side.
